You can connect the printer using the serial interface.  You can
configure a logical device with one of the preset configurations (I
forget which one off hand, but I think it is PR22D96 or PR18D96 (which
ever one does not send status messages since the LaserJet cannot do it).

You'll need to build a cable with the DTC connecter on one end and a
25-pin serial connector on the other.  There are only three pins used:
2, 3, and 7 so building the cable should be easy.  HP Direct probably
sells a cable which might cost a bit more than usual, but it will
eliminate the time needed to build your own.
